How they compare
Croatia currently reports 1.06 against 1.04 in Colombia, a difference of 0.02.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 35 shared years of data; in 1990 it was Colombia ahead.
Colombia ranks 116th and Croatia ranks 114th of 200 countries.
Colombia has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Colombia | Croatia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 2.03 | 1.3 | 0.726 | Colombia |
| 2000s | 1.61 | 0.7649 | 0.8413 | Colombia |
| 2010s | 1.24 | 0.6542 | 0.5873 | Colombia |
| 2020s | 1.09 | 0.8598 | 0.226 | Colombia |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
